My real problem with that approach is that it has these icky
hard-coded constraints in there.  Magic constants always get me into
trouble, and assuming that the installation data will always be 10K or
less just strikes me as bad.  I'd much rather go to two files than
accept such a hack solution, that's for sure.  Make me a better
offer.. :-)

I can say that I've made a few decisions in the last couple days'
worth of contemplation.

	The general extension language for this whole thing will be tcl 7.5.

 I've looked at forth and I've looked at scheme and I've looked at my
own stuff and I've even looked at PERL and only TCL seems to strike
the right balance between the space it eats and the power it provides.
It's also got a rich toolchest for bolting in other things (can you
imagine how useful a TCL-aware installer with ``expect'' functionality
compiled in would be?  You could use the stand-alone floppy as a
serial line analyser.. :-) and we can go graphical with Tk in the
immediate term while we evolve a strategy for being pan-platform.

Heck, maybe I'll just eat my words and see if we can't construct Tk
interfaces that are simple enough to be displayed with Ctk.. :) [only
those who remember my "Ctk sucks!  No!  No!" postings will really find
this suggestion funny :)]

It would be a very expedient solution with a fairly high return, and
even if Ctk turns out to be too badly broken to use, well, then
Michael gets his wish and we start making getting into X a higher
priority - at least we know that Tk works well.


The other big advantage to TCL is that I know it pretty well, I know
how to extend it and I've figured out how to deal with C-side abstract
types pretty well using various types of hash table manipulation.
We could do at lot with it, and make all of the basic primitives
in sysinstall tcl callable.

OK, I'll set to you then a challenge:

Can you write a setup program for X that probes for mouse type (this
is easy to do - there are standard interrogation sequences that the
XFree86 people know and can tell you), presents a table of monitors
and graphics cards, tests the server and gets the user to feedback on
whether or not they saw whatever test pattern was put up, returning
them to the setup program until they do.

xf86config is just too horrible to contemplate, and looking at Xsetup
from the X Inside distribution (see the demo in the commerce
distribution) gives a much clearer picture of what we'd like to see.
The X Inside people *do* have a 99% success rate, and what's more we
even have their server! :-) The demo version will let you launch, I
believe, 4 clients.  That's a WM, the setup utility, an xterm and a
clock.. :-)

However, I'm a little loath to lean on a demo server when it only
gets the user sort of installed and then leaves them without X again
since the config work they did isn't actually applicable to XFree86.
We need an xf86config replacement!

> From the point of view of the script controlling the installation, there's
> no difference.  When the forms interpreter finishes running the form, it
> returns a set of values.  End of story.

Ah, the forms interface perspective.  I guess you're right about this,
though I'd like some real-time callback ability on the individual
subcomponents this time, not the static libdialog crud which never let
me say "if these two are on, turn that one OFF!" for callback checks.

If we can meet in the middle here, I think taking the forms approach
is the right basic way to go.  Just don't make it so high level that
my forms become "dumb" like the libdialog objects.
